While aimed at a nationwide audience, this webinar fulfills the California Board of Behavioral Sciences mandate for 3 hours of telehealth training for all their licensees -- even if you don’t provide telehealth! CE details are below.

CE CREDITS: This course meets the criteria for the mandatory one-time 3-hour telehealth course required by the California Board of Behavioral Sciences for LCSWs, LMFTs, LPCCs, LEPs, and Registered Associates (click here for more details about this). It can ALSO be counted as 3 LEGAL AND ETHICAL CE CREDITS for California LCSWs, LMFTs, LPCCs, LEPs and Associates AND can be counted as 3 CE credits toward your mandatory 2-year renewal totals. That is, it can be triple counted. Other licensees should check with their licensing board for possible credit. CEs can be obtained by watching the recording. PRESENTER: Benjamin E. Caldwell, PsyD is a California Licensed Marriage and Family Therapist and Adjunct Faculty for California State University Northridge. He is the author of Basics of California Law for LMFTs, LPCCs, and LCSWs, and lead author of AAMFT’s Best Practices in the Online Practice of Couple and Family Therapy. He has published and presented around the country on issues related to ethics, technology, supervision, and professional development.
